Antenatal checkups are a series of medical appointments with a doctor, obstetrician, or midwife from the moment you confirm your pregnancy until you give birth. Their primary goal is to monitor the health and well-being of both you and your developing baby, identify any potential risks or complications early, and provide you with essential information and support for a safe delivery.

It’s highly recommended to begin your antenatal care as soon as you confirm your pregnancy. Early care allows your doctor to establish your estimated due date, conduct initial screenings, and provide vital advice from the very beginning. This early start helps ensure a strong foundation for a healthy pregnancy journey.
Selecting the right clinic or healthcare provider for your antenatal checkups is a personal decision. Consider factors like location, hospital affiliation, the doctor’s experience, and the clinic’s facilities. Finding a place where you feel comfortable and confident in your care is paramount.
